Caladenia hildae Pescott & Nicholls 1928 SUBGEN. Stegostyla ( D.L.Jones & M.A.Clem. ) Szlach. 2003 Photo courtesy of Cathy Powers and her AUSTRALIAN TERRESTRIAL ORCHID OTHER FLORA & FAUNA BANJORAH Website
Common Name Hilda's Caladenia
Flower Size 3/4" [2 cm]
A miniature sized, cold to cool growing terrestrial from Eastern Australian occuring in open forest with open heathy under-story mainly in granite-based loamy soil that flowers there in the spring on an erect, to 1 3/4" [4.5 cm] long, single flowered inflorescence.
Synonyms Caladenia testacea var. hildae ( Pescott & Nicholls ) Nicholls 1939; Stegostyla hildae ( Pescott & Nicholls ) D.L.Jones & M.A.Clem. 2001 2001
